@@ -1171,6 +1171,7 @@ def test_{{ method_name }}_rest_required_fields(request_type={{ method.input.ide
11711171
11721172 response_value._content = json_return_value.encode('UTF-8')
11731173 req.return_value = response_value
1174+ req.return_value.headers = {"header-1": "value-1", "header-2": "value-2"}
11741175
11751176 {% if method .client_streaming %}
11761177 response = client.{{ method_name }}(iter(requests))
@@ -1263,6 +1264,7 @@ def test_{{ method_name }}_rest_flattened():
12631264 {% endif %}
12641265 response_value._content = json_return_value.encode('UTF-8')
12651266 req.return_value = response_value
1267+ req.return_value.headers = {"header-1": "value-1", "header-2": "value-2"}
12661268
12671269 {% if method .server_streaming %}
12681270 with mock.patch.object(response_value, 'iter_content') as iter_content:
@@ -1796,6 +1798,7 @@ def test_initialize_client_w_{{transport_name}}():
17961798 response_value.status_code = 400
17971799 response_value.request = mock.Mock()
17981800 req.return_value = response_value
1801+ req.return_value.headers = {"header-1": "value-1", "header-2": "value-2"}
17991802 {{ await_prefix }}client.{{ method_name }}(request)
18001803
18011804{% endif %} {# if 'grpc' in transport #}
@@ -1846,6 +1849,7 @@ def test_initialize_client_w_{{transport_name}}():
18461849 response_value.request = Request()
18471850 {% endif %}
18481851 req.return_value = response_value
1852+ req.return_value.headers = {"header-1": "value-1", "header-2": "value-2"}
18491853 {{ await_prefix }}client.{{ method_name }}(request)
18501854{% endif %} {# if 'grpc' in transport #}
18511855{% endmacro %}
@@ -2029,6 +2033,7 @@ def test_initialize_client_w_{{transport_name}}():
20292033 {% endif %} {# is_async #}
20302034 {% endif %} {# method.server_streaming #}
20312035 req.return_value = response_value
2036+ req.return_value.headers = {"header-1": "value-1", "header-2": "value-2"}
20322037 response = {{ await_prefix }}client.{{ method_name }}(request)
20332038 {% if "next_page_token" in method_output .fields .values ()|map (attribute ='name' , default ="" ) and not method .paged_result_field %}
20342039 {# TODO(https://github.com/googleapis/gapic-generator-python/issues/2199): The following assert statement is added to force
@@ -2139,6 +2144,7 @@ def test_initialize_client_w_{{transport_name}}():
21392144 {% endif %}
21402145
21412146 req.return_value = response_value
2147+ req.return_value.headers = {"header-1": "value-1", "header-2": "value-2"}
21422148
21432149 response = {{ await_prefix }}client.{{ method_name }}(request)
21442150
@@ -2232,6 +2238,7 @@ def test_initialize_client_w_{{transport_name}}():
22322238
22332239 req.return_value = mock.Mock()
22342240 req.return_value.status_code = 200
2241+ req.return_value.headers = {"header-1": "value-1", "header-2": "value-2"}
22352242 {% if not method .void %}
22362243 return_value = {% if method .output .ident .is_proto_plus_type %} {{ method.output.ident }}.to_json({{ method.output.ident }}()){% else %} json_format.MessageToJson({{ method.output.ident }}()){% endif %}
22372244
0 commit comments